Assessing Your Fitness Level and Goals

Before diving into creating a workout plan, your trainer needs to understand where you’re starting from. This initial assessment forms the foundation for everything that follows. A professional fitness trainer in Singapore will evaluate:

  • Current fitness level: They’ll assess your strength, endurance, flexibility, and cardiovascular health through simple tests or observations.
  • Body composition: Your trainer may check your muscle-to-fat ratio to better understand where adjustments need to be made.
  • Specific goals: Whether you aim to lose weight, build muscle, improve endurance, or rehabilitate after an injury, your trainer will tailor the program to target these goals directly.

By gathering this information, your trainer can design a plan that aligns perfectly with your unique needs and fitness aspirations.

Tailoring the Workout Plan

Once the assessment is complete, the fun begins! Based on the insights gathered, your trainer will craft a customised workout plan with exercises that align with your fitness level and objectives. Key components of the plan include:

Exercise Selection

Choosing the right combination of exercises is critical to achieving your goals. Whether you’re focusing on building muscle, increasing endurance, or toning specific areas, your trainer will select exercises that give you the best results. For example:

  • Strength training for muscle gain, using exercises like squats, deadlifts, and bench presses.
  • Cardio for fat loss or improved cardiovascular health, with activities like running, cycling, or HIIT (High-Intensity Interval Training).
  • Flexibility and mobility exercises to improve range of motion and prevent injury, like yoga or dynamic stretching.

Workout Frequency

Your trainer will determine how many times per week you should work out based on your goals, fitness level, and recovery time. Whether it’s 3, 4, or 5 days per week, the number of sessions will be balanced to avoid overtraining and ensure adequate rest.

Progressive Overload

A good fitness trainer in Singapore knows that progress comes with gradual challenges. They’ll incorporate progressive overload—the practice of gradually increasing the intensity, duration, or volume of your workouts. This prevents plateaus and helps you keep improving without risking injury.

Adapting to Your Needs and Lifestyle

Life is busy, and a one-size-fits-all approach often doesn’t work. A customised workout plan goes beyond just exercises—it takes into account your lifestyle, preferences, and potential limitations.

Schedule Flexibility

A trainer will work around your schedule, ensuring that your fitness plan fits into your daily routine. Whether you’re training early in the morning or late in the evening, the program will be adaptable to when you’re most likely to stick to it.

Injury Considerations

If you’re recovering from an injury or dealing with a chronic condition, your fitness trainer will modify exercises to avoid aggravating the injury while still allowing for progress. For instance, a trainer may suggest low-impact exercises like swimming or cycling to prevent strain on sensitive areas.

Personal Preferences

Your trainer will also consider the types of workouts you enjoy. If you hate running but love cycling, they can incorporate more cycling-based cardio into your routine. Finding activities you enjoy makes it much easier to stay committed in the long term.

Why Personalised Training Works

There are several key reasons why a customised approach to fitness is so effective.

Faster Results

When your workouts are designed specifically for your body and goals, you’re likely to see faster results compared to a generic plan. Whether you’re training for strength, fat loss, or endurance, a tailored program ensures every exercise has a purpose.

Injury Prevention

With customised workouts, your trainer ensures that you’re using the right form and technique, which helps prevent injury. They’ll also provide modifications or alternative exercises if necessary to accommodate injuries or physical limitations.

Consistency and Accountability

Having a trainer by your side ensures accountability. You’re more likely to show up for workouts when you know someone is expecting you and tracking your progress. Additionally, your trainer will motivate you to push past mental barriers, keeping you consistent and focused on your goals.

How to Find the Right Fitness Trainer in Singapore

Now that you understand how a fitness trainer plans your workout, you may be wondering how to find one who’s right for you. When searching for a fitness trainer, consider the following:

  • Certifications and Experience: Ensure the trainer is certified by a reputable organization such as NASM, ACE, or ISSA. Experience in your specific goal (e.g., weight loss, muscle gain, rehab) is a plus.
  • Specialisation: Choose a trainer who specializes in the type of training you’re interested in—whether it’s strength training, cardiovascular fitness, or injury rehabilitation.
  • Communication Style: Make sure their coaching style matches your personality. Whether you prefer a tough coach or someone more supportive, finding a good match is key to long-term success.
  • Location and Availability: Ensure the trainer’s schedule and location work with your own. Many trainers in Singapore offer both in-person and online sessions, making it easier to fit workouts into your busy life.
